Our Men and Boys Engagement Program focuses on engaging men and boys to promote gender equality, child rights, and the overall welfare of women and children. Through this program, we challenge harmful gender norms and promote healthier, more inclusive models of masculinity. The interventions help men and boys understand how issues like gender-based violence, toxic masculinity, and cultural practices such as FGM and child marriage affect not only women and girls but also their health, social, and economic well-being.
This initiative seeks to bring together men to transform their attitude, from perpetrators of violence to becoming active allies in ending violence, promoting child advocacy and protection, and fostering community child support.
